Herbie’s camp in Ridgecrest, California, is located right between the highest mountain peak and the lowest elevation basin in the contiguous 48 United States of America.
The summit of Mt. Whitney reaches a total height of 14,505 feet (4,202 m).
Mount Whitney is just 85 miles (136 km) East-Southeast of Death Valley.
Death Valley’s basin Badwater has the lowest elevation in North America.
The Badwater basin in Death Valley, at 282 feet (86 m) below sea level, also holds the record for the highest reported temperature in Western hemisphere, 134 °F (56.7 °C).
